Schools Are Cautious for Good Reasons


You have heard the concerns in staff meetings: cheating, overreliance, inaccurate outputs, no visibility into what students paste where. Pushing "everyone use ChatGPT" without structure creates more problems than it solves.


The better question is not whether to use AI. It is how AI can support teachers without replacing classroom structure, pedagogy, or oversight.
